Thailand mulls second frigate order from South Korea’s DSME
South Korean Defense Minister met with the Thai Prime Minister and Minister of Defence in December. Discussions included current security issues and procurement of an additional frigate.

The Royal Thai Navy tested the MARCUS-B (Maritime Aerial Reconnaissance Craft Unmanned System-B) Vertical Take-Off and Landing drone aboard the HTMS Chakri Naruebet (CVH-911), the country’s sole aircraft carrier.

UK-based maritime classification society Lloyd’s Register will provide assurance and certification services for vessels being built in China for the Algerian Navy (likely similar to the Pattani-class or Centenary-class) and the Royal Thai Navy (an LPD based on the Type 071 class)

Yet another C-Guard Decoy Launching System delivery from Terma who recently completed a successful Sea Acceptance Test (SAT) for the Royal Thai Navy OPV Krabi Class.

Schiebel won a competitive tender to supply its Camcopter S-100 System to the Royal Thai Navy (RTN), the Austrian company said on November 4, 2019.

Chinese shipbuilding group CSIC (China Shipbuilding Industry Corporation) held a keel laying ceremony for the Royal Thai Navy’s first S26T submarine. The event took place on September 5, 2019 at a shipyard in Wuhan, China.

The second Krabi-class offshore patrol vessel (OPV) for the Royal Thai Navy (Kong Thap Ruea Thai / กองทัพเรือไทย) was launched today.
